But at last this means we can be shown to birthmothers.  Basically, the agency has a list of "situations" that we would be comfortable adopting from.  This ranges from birthmother activities during pregnancy to the amount of contact post placement that we are willing to accept.

When the agency has a birthmother that falls within our criteria they will show our profile along with any other waiting adoptive families that also meet the criteria.  (They do not notify us when we are and aren't being shown.  For which I am glad, because that takes off a whole different set of anxieties.)  The birthmother is then allowed to read our letter written to her and see our photo album about ourselves.  The birthmother can then pick a set of adoptive parents or they can request meetings with ones that they like in order to get a better feel for the couple/family.  The birthmother then will make a decision upon who they would like their child placed with.  Sometimes this process happens within the last few weeks or days of the pregnancy and sometimes an adoption plan is made at the hospital shortly after a birthmother has given birth.
